Q: In what year did production of the first-generation Toyota Land Cruiser begin?
1951
Q: What was the first car released by Japanese automaker Nissan under the revived Datsun brand in 2013?
Datsun Go
Q: What was Volkswagen's first minivan offered in North America after the Volkswagen EuroVan was discontinued in 2003?
Volkswagen Routan
Q: What was General Motors' first MPV offering in India?
Chevrolet Enjoy
Q: What was the first V6-powered sedan offered by Suzuki called?
Suzuki Verona
Q: What was the third Skoda vehicle to be both developed and produced in India?
Skoda Kylaq
Q: Who was the first Thai driver to secure a victory in Formula 3?
Tasanapol Inthraphuvasak
Q: What was the first Morgan model equipped with an eight-speed transmission?
Morgan Plus Six
Q: What was the first model in Renault's Stella series?
Renault Reinastella
Q: Which present-day brand was the world's largest automotive parts supplier in the 1910s?
Dodge
Q: What was the first production car to acc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in four seconds?
Shelby Cobra 427
Q: In what year was DS Automobiles, a French luxury-premium marque, created?
2009
Q: Who was the first Indian and Asian driver signed by the F1 Academy driver program?
Atiqa Mir
Q: Who was the first woman to win the Monte Carlo Rally?
Mildred Mary Bruce
Q: What was the concept car presented by Lancia in 1974, which had four gullwing doors, called?
Lancia Beta Mizar
Q: What was the first carmaker in the world to fit all its models with power steering as standard?
Cadillac
Q: In what year was the BMW M3 first introduced?
1986
Q: The first prototype of the Porsche 916 was created for Ferdinand Piech's daughter. What was her name?
Corina Piech
Q: In what year did Volvo invent the modern three-point seatbelt?
1959
Q: Which model was Mercedes-Benz's first application of the Two-Mode hybrid powertrain?
Mercedes-Benz ML 450 Hybrid
